Dr. Vasja Vehovar, head of the Centre for Social Informatics, and Dr. Dejan Jontes published an original scientific article titled From Criticism to Anger and Hate: The Vulgarisation of Digital Anti-Press Criticism on News Outlets’ Facebook Pages in the journal Digital Journalism.
The paper explores audiences’ hateful responses towards journalists and the media in news stories about migrants and LGBT-related topics in three of the most popular national news outlets’ Facebook pages in Slovenia. Theoretically the paper is situated within the theory of metajournalistic discourse, and it argues that various forms of online harassment and the vulgarization of anti-press criticism could be considered as a form of boundary work that occurs though metajournalistic discourse. The qualitative research of 314 comments shows that, in the analysed comments, (negative) emotional audience’s responses dominate and that rational criticism is prevailingly replaced with emotional cynicism or harassment of journalists and the media. In this context, a typology of emotional responses is proposed and a thesis about the vulgarisation of digital anti-press criticism is advanced.
